我们可以使用多种工具安装 Ruby。本章节主要介绍如何通过主流的包管理器和第三方工具管理和安装 Ruby,以及如何通过源码编译安装。 1. 包管理器 如果使用的是类 UNIX 操作系统,而且只需要安装一个版本的 Ruby,使用系统的包管理器是最简单的安装方式。 经验:在实际生产模式的时候,我们在一个服务器可能会有多个项目会依赖不同版本的 Ruby 版本,这个时候就需要我们在一个服务器中安装多个版本
源码安装 export RTE_SDK="/usr/src/dpdk" export DPDK_VERSION="2.2.0" export RTE_TARGET="x86_64-native-linuxapp-gcc" ######################## ubuntu ###################################### apt-get install -y
SQL Server sa 登录名是服务器级的主体。默认情况下,它是在安装时创建的。在 SQL Server 2005 或以上,sa 的默认数据库为 master。这是对早期版本的 SQL Server 的行为的改变。 创建数据库时,数据库默认包含 guest 用户。授予 guest 用户的权限由在数据库中没有用户帐号的用户继承。不能删除 guest 用户,但可通过撤消该用户的 CONNECT 权
如果Sphinx构建失败,请您按照以下步骤进行: 确认您的DBMS的头文件和库文件都正确安装了(例如,检查mysql-devel包已经安装) 报告Sphinx的版本和配置文件(别忘了删除数据库连接密码),MySQL(或PostgreSQL)配置文件信息,gcc版本,操作系统版本和CPU类型(例如x86、x86-64、PowerPC等): mysql_config gcc --version una
为了安装最新版本的seaborn, 可以 pip命令: pip install seaborn 也可以使用 conda 命令安装: conda install seaborn 或者,您可以使用 pip 直接从github安装开发版本: pip install git+https://github.com/mwaskom/seaborn.git 另外的方法是从 github仓库 下载,从本地安
本安装说明是提供给那些想在多种环境中安装 Docker 的 hacker 们的。 在进行安装之前,请检查你的 Linux 发行版本是否有打包好的 Docker 安装包。我们已经发布了许多发行版包,这样会节省您很多时间。 检查运行时的依赖关系 如果想要 Docker 正常运行,需要安装以下软件: iptables version 1.4 or later Git version 1.7 or lat
由 Rackspace 提供的 Ubuntu 安装 Docker 是非常简单的,你可以大多按照Ubuntu的安装指南。 不过请注意: 如果你使用的 Linux 发行版没有运行 3.8 内核,你就必须升级内核,这个在 Rackspace 上是有些困难的。 Rackspace 使用 grub 的 menu.lst 启动服务,虽然它们运行正常,但是并不像非虚拟软件包(如xen兼容)内核那样。所以你必须手
1.创建一个 IBM SoftLayer 账户. 2.登陆到 SoftLayer Customer Portal. 3.在 Devices 菜单中选择设备列表. 4.点击位于菜单条下方、窗口顶部右侧的 Order Devices. 5.在 Virtual Server 下点击 Hourly. 6.创建一个新的 SoftLayer Virtual Server Instance (VSI),使用全部
在CRUX Linux可以通过由 James Mills 提供的 ports,或者官方的 contrib ports. docker docker port 将构建安装最新版本的 Docker。 安装 如果你的版本允许,更新你的 ports 目录树并且安装docker(用root用户): # prt-get depinst docker 如果你想节省你的编译时间,你可以安装docker-bin
你可以使用 Arch Linux 社区发布的 Docker 软件包进行安装: docker 或者使用 AUR 包 docker-git docker 软件包将会安装最新版本的 Docker。docker-git 则是由当前master分支构建的包。 依赖关系 Docker 依赖于几个指定的安装包,核心的几个依赖包为: bridge-utils device-mapper iproute2 lxc
BECOMING SECURE AND ANONYMOUS 今天,几乎我们在互联网上做的一切都被跟踪。无论是谷歌跟踪我们的在线搜索、网站访问和电子邮件,还是美国国家安全局(NSA)对我们的所有活动进行编目,无论谁在跟踪我们,我们的每一次在线活动都会被记录、编入索引,然后被挖掘出来,以造福他人。普通个人,尤其是黑客,需要了解如何限制这种跟踪,并在网上保持相对匿名,以限制这种无处不在的监视。 在本章中
要想使用SystemTap,需要安装跟目标内核版本匹配的-devel、-debuginfo和-debuginfo-common-arch包。如果要在不止一个内核上运行SystemTap,需要根据每个内核的版本安装对应的-devel和-debuginfo包。 接下来的几个小节里,我们会详细讲解这一过程。(译注:SystemTap的wiki里面有针对Linux各发行版的安装步骤。本节内容仅适用于RHE
Neo4j自身并不会正数据层级加强安全性。然而,在使用Neo4j到不同场景时应该考虑不同的情况。 24.1. 安全访问Neo4j服务器 24.1.1. 加强端口和远程客户端连接请求的安全 默认情况下,Neo4j服务端会捆绑一个Web服务器,服务在 7474端口,通过地址: http://localhost:7474/访问,不过只能从本地访问。 在配置文件 conf/neo4j-server.pro
CocoaPods 环境安装 关于CocoaPods CocoaPods是iOS开发、macOS开发中的包依赖管理工具,效果如Java中的Maven,nodejs的npm。 CocoaPods是一个开源的项目,源码是用ruby写的,源码地址在GitHub上。 无论是做iOS开发还是macOS开发,都不可避免的要使用到一些第三方库,优秀的第三方库能够提升我们的开发效率。如果不使用包依赖管理工具,我们
K8s集群搭建 手动搭建kubernetes集群 解决k8s出现pod服务一直处于ContainerCreating状态的问题 kubernetes 安装遇到的坑 (1) kubernetes dashboard 安装 centos7.3 kubernetes/k8s 1.10 离线安装